Output 52ac68311ea2d9d74bfc9da47bca12b8e06fbfe0efd4bbec3b20c77f23b37624:0

value
15179295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ea5bdddf82e731cf73f455fe8b49b2d32697dab OP_EQUAL
address
3HcU3rZHxgHxwJY2Bi85H4heYHNGjev3va
transaction
52ac68311ea2d9d74bfc9da47bca12b8e06fbfe0efd4bbec3b20c77f23b37624
spent
true